If you want a fun and easy snack to make with your toddler, try these Peanut Butter Balls. They are highly suggested and super delicious! 

I want to list a few benefits of why Peanut Butter Balls are one of our household’s favorite snacks.

  1. If you are a nursing mama, oats and coconut flakes can increase your milk production for that beautiful liquid gold!
  2. Eating 2-3 of the Peanut Butter Balls is a filler for an adult my size (5’1, 130lbs)
  3. They are not only easy to make, but your toddler will enjoy making them with you, which will be a cherishing memory for both of you. (Your toddler might be encouraged to want to bake/ cook in the future making it easy on you, mama!)
  4. The energy balls only take about 15minutes to make outside of the 30-45min refrigerator time before rolling the balls.
  5. When making in bulk, you can store the Peanut Butter Balls in the refrigerator for up to 3 weeks. (If they last! From experience, we make these weekly because we usually devour them within the 3rd day)

If you do not believe me, take a chance and make them. The experience alone with baking with your little one is enough sweetness! 

 

Note to self: Please do not have high expectations when making these treats. I suggest toddler-friendly baking bowls and spoons, as well as wipes and napkins for the mess. Easy clean up.
